Championship Schedule
2029 U.S. Women’s Amateur
2031 U.S. Women’s Open
2034 U.S. Open
2038 U.S. Girls’ Junior Amateur
2042 U.S. Women’s Open
2047 U.S. Amateur
2051 U.S. Open

About Oakland Hills Country Club
Founded in 1916, with
Walter Hagen
as its first club professional, Oakland Hills Country Club is a 36-hole Donald Ross-designed private club that has hosted
17 major championships
.
Legends such as
Gary Player
,
Arnold Palmer
,
Jack Nicklaus
, and
Ben Hogan
have competed here—Hogan famously referred to the South Course as
“The Monster.”
